#9
Ya upgrading headers and running high flow secondaries is the only real way but that's much more invasive.
Realistically what you could do is keep your stock header and primaries and just run cat bypass for secondaries (straight pipes), as long as there are no 02 sensors rear of the secondaries you should be good as far as CEL goes. Straight pipes would be cheap
